Newbie Ford Tempo owner
 
Hello! I found this site looking for information on vortex generators, and seeing that there's tons of other discussions for aero mods, I thought I'd drop in.

I'm actually more interested in eliminating aerodynamic lift than anything, and if I can decrease drag at the same time, all the better.

My car is a 1991 Ford Tempo GL, and I've already done a couple of aero mods.

The first thing I did was install hood vents to reduce front-end lift and promote increased engine cooling.

Second, I pulled that flap under the radiator forward to act like a scoop, so that if either air is pushed up by it, or air pushes down on it, downforce will be created. ^^

Third, I installed some tire spats in front of the rear tires, using my front license plate holder for material. Turns out they're the full width of the tread!

I'm considering vortex generators, since the rear window angle on a '91 Tempo is about 35 degrees, give or take, but I first want to find out if I'll be increasing lift by using them. If that's the case, I'll pair them with a decklid spoiler to counter that lift.
